Output 3f864da52186720251337bc1f68a2b6cb289a2541b09b2918aac056a8566d801:0

value
583632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 758f08c8b71d4c526055712e739b2177726eb12c OP_EQUALVERIFY OP_CHECKSIG
address
1BibQeG9AsztVnEJSZThRjVeHHAKqQ1ndN
transaction
3f864da52186720251337bc1f68a2b6cb289a2541b09b2918aac056a8566d801
spent
true